Wait Until Dark

Production Dates: May 1–3, 7–9 Directed by Darve Smith, this 2013 adaptation by Jeffrey Hatcher reimagines Frederick Knott’s classic 1966 thriller. Set in 1944 Greenwich Village, the story follows Susan Hendrix, a blind woman who finds herself terrorized by a trio of con men searching for a mysterious doll hidden in her apartment. As the tension peaks, Susan realizes her only advantage is to lure her tormentors into her own world of total darkness.

The Addams Family

Production Dates: August 6–9, 13–15 Directed by Kevin Knox, this musical comedy features the iconic macabre family facing a "normal" nightmare: their daughter Wednesday has grown up and fallen in love with a sweet young man from a respectable family. As the Addams family hosts a dinner for the boyfriend and his parents, Gomez must do the unthinkable and keep a secret from his beloved Morticia, leading to a night where secrets are revealed and relationships are tested.

A Christmas Carol

Production Dates: December 3–6, 10–12 Directed by Kevin Knox and Larry Bose, this classic holiday tale follows the miserly Ebenezer Scrooge as he is visited by the ghost of his former partner, Jacob Marley, and the spirits of Christmas Past, Present, and Yet to Come. Through these supernatural encounters, Scrooge is forced to confront his selfish ways and rediscover the importance of charity, kindness, and the true spirit of the season.
